2.Kalidou Koulibaly

Senegal’s hopes of another World Cup quarter-final rest on defensive solidity from Kalidou Koulibaly alongside moments of magic from Sadio Mané. You know this central back from his fantastic season at his club, Napoli.

Those who have watched Koulibaly at the heart of Napoli’s defence this season will not have been surprised by the 26-year-old’s impressive performance. He has been outstanding for Sarri’s team this season, providing the rock-solid foundation on which the team’s breathtakingly intricate attacking football is based. He was also responsible for the most exciting moment of their season – scoring a dramatic late header against Juventus to blow the Scudetto title race wide open – only for Napoli to drop points in their next two games and eventually finish second.

Having scored 4 times for Napoli this season, this towering defender is also a threat at the other end. His calm yet commanding presence at the back made him a front-runner of the African Player of the Year, only losing out to the impeccable Mohamed Salah.

No wonder, Koulibaly will be quite a treat to watch when Senegal battles out in June.These talents were on full display in Moscow against Poland. Koulibaly had numerous opportunities to demonstrate his passing ability, while he impressed coping with Poland’s aerial threat.

In short, it was a display that demonstrated perfectly why he would surely excel in the Premier League. Against Poland, Koulibaly got the basics right: confident under the high ball, dragging his team-mates into position and marshalling Lewandowski throughout.

Factor in the more expansive, elaborate side of his game that he has exhibited in the Serie A this season, and it becomes clear why clubs such as Manchester United, Arsenal and Chelsea have all been linked with a £60m move.
